TC Man Blackmailed Over Nude Photos

Dec. 1, 2015

A 23-year-old Traverse City man tells police he was blackmailed after sharing naked images of himself online.

The man received a Facebook friend request last week and Skyped with a woman while he exposed himself for 10 to 15 minutes, says Traverse City Police Department Interim Chief Jeff O’Brien.

Next, the man received a message from someone who demanded $150 paid to an African bank or the compromising video would be shared on YouTube. The man paid the hush money. The following day, on Thanksgiving, another message made the same request, but demanded $3,500. This time the man didn’t pay and went to police.

O’Brien says this kind of case is rarely solved but serves as a public service message for anyone who considers sharing private images online.

“The moral of this story is, ‘Don’t do that,’” O’Brien says. “The Internet is not private.”
